Flat rate £4 for home office?

Hi Guys, as a limited company, I know I’m entitled to claim a flat rate £4 a week for my home office (where I do all of my work) without having to provide additional paperwork to HMRC.

I was wondering how I log this in QuickFile? Can this be logged as a company expense as I am currently not taking a wage as a director.

Yes you can create new nominal and tag it as use of home

Thank you, can advise on what nominal code I could use? In what range? Also, where does the money go? Do I need to set myself up as a supplier?

Create new nominal “Use of Home” in Admin range and money goes out of bank to your account, no need to setup supplier

And if you don’t actually take the money out of the company at this stage then you’d record it as paid from director’s loan rather than from current account, to record that the company owes you money - the same as if you pay for a company expense using your own personal funds.
